Tummy aches are a childhood classic—but what if it’s something more serious? In this episode, we explore acute appendicitis, the sneaky condition that can turn a normal day into an emergency.
Omega Pediatrics walks us through how to tell the difference between a garden-variety stomach bug and the early signs of appendicitis. We talk pain patterns, red flags, and why acting fast can make all the difference. It’s everything parents need to know to trust their gut—when their child’s gut might be in trouble.
